Transaction 5759edcfa257797c021451614af92ffe391c62bf76da99e35e55cbe1718880eb

1 Input
2 Outputs
  • 5759edcfa257797c021451614af92ffe391c62bf76da99e35e55cbe1718880eb:0
  • value  99974
    address  3DVBsczG9r4vYXGDX195jUhQX2WSFkMJka
  • 5759edcfa257797c021451614af92ffe391c62bf76da99e35e55cbe1718880eb:1
  • value  1880579
    address  bc1q7j5ruqrvae733wsr5c4u2p8gzh4tefh9hlys65